Return of the Living Dead

ROTLDvideoJust when you thought it was safe to go back to the cemetery, those brain-eating zombies are coming back for a second helping! MGM Home Entertainment is producing a new special edition of cult classic Return of the Living Dead. According to Michael Allred, who spear-headed the original web campaign to bring the horror comedy to DVD back in 2002, the new disc is currently in production with a release date to be announced.

Full details on the bonus materials aren’t yet known, but actors Beverly Randolph , Brian Peck and Linnea Quigley, along with production designer William Stout, have been confirmed for a commentary track recording session later this month.

But it also appears that this new edition will be absent of any new participation from writer/director Dan O’Bannon, who is currently in litigation with the studio over residual payments from the 1985 horror comedy.
